I'll admit, the tail wheel assy looks weak, but I have lots of flights on mine and it's still hanging in there. I might consider changing out the pushrods for sullivans. The Sig ones are really sensative to temp changes. This is probably the most enjoyable building experiance I've had to date. I've got a .52 mag fs for power, suits this plane perfectly.
